摘要

以非离子型表面活性剂为唯一聚合乳化剂,丙烯酸-2-乙基己基酯和甲基丙烯酸甲酯为主单体,甲基丙烯酸为亲水单体,阳离子型偶氮二异丙基咪唑啉盐酸盐为聚合引发剂,后添加阳离子型表面活性剂16-29(十六烷基三甲基氣化铵),制备了高性能的阳离子丙烯酸酯共聚物乳液。考察了非离子型乳化剂用量对反应稳定性的影响,试验了阳离子引发剂用量对单体转化率的影响,测试了甲基丙烯酸用量对反应稳定性及乳液漆膜附着力的影响,考察了玻璃化转变温度对乳液清漆膜性能的影响,试验了胺类表面活性剂加量对附着力和耐黄变的影响。结果表明:非离子型表面活性剂Emulgen 1150S-70的用量为单体的6%时,反应的絮凝物量最少;阳离子引发剂的用量为单体的0.3%时,单体的转化率高;甲基丙烯酸用量为2%时,反应的稳定性佳,漆膜性能优异;玻璃化转变温度约25.3℃时,漆膜的综合性能最佳;表面活性剂16-29用量为配方量的0.2%时,附着力最佳,耐黄变性优。

Abstract

Prepared cationic acrylic emulsion with excellent properties by 2-EHA and MMA with nonionic emulsifier as only emulsifier,MAA as the polymerization hydrophilic monomer,the cationic initiator 2,2′-azobis(1-methylethylidene)bis 4,5-dihydro-1H-imidazole dihydrochloride as polymerizing initiator,post addition of cationic surfactant 16-29(hexadecyltrimethyl ammonium chloride).The dosage of nonionic emulsifier Emulgen 1150S-70 to polymerization stability,the dosage of initiator to monomer conversion,the dosage of MAA to polymerization and film adhesion,glass transition temperature to film properties,the dosage of cationic surfactant 16-29 to film adhesion and yellowing resistance were tested.The results show that the 6%dosage of nonionic emulsifier to total monomer weight has best polymerizing stability,the 0.3%dosage of cationic initiator to total monomer weight has high monomer conversion,the 2%dosage of MAA to total monomer weight has good stability and film performance,the glass transition temperature with about 25.3℃ has good film properties,the 0.2%dosage of cationic surfactant 16-29 has good adhesion and yellowing resistance.
